Welcome to Yancheng Nanyang International Airport. This airport serves the city of Yancheng in East China's Jiangsu province. It is located in the town of Nanyang, just 8.3 km from the city center. Yancheng Airport opened for commercial domestic flights in 2000 and expanded to international flights in 2008. Yancheng Nanyang International Airport: A Comprehensive Guide

Introduction

Yancheng Nanyang International Airport (IATA: YNZ, ICAO: ZSYN) serves as a vital air transportation hub for the city of Yancheng, located in the Jiangsu province of East China. Situated approximately 8.3 kilometers (5.2 miles) from the city center, this airport has been operational since 2000, initially offering domestic flights, with international services commencing in 2008. As the second-largest airport in Jiangsu province, Yancheng Nanyang International Airport plays a crucial role in connecting travelers to various destinations across China and beyond.

Airlines and Destinations

Yancheng Nanyang International Airport is serviced by a variety of airlines, providing connections to numerous destinations. Currently, the airport offers non-stop flights to 27 destinations, primarily within China, including major cities such as Beijing, Shanghai, Guangzhou, and Shenzhen. The airlines operating from YNZ include:

  • China Southern Airlines
  • Chengdu Airlines
  • Lucky Air
  • Xiamen Airlines
  • Spring Airlines
  • Air China

Number of Passengers and Flights

In recent years, Yancheng Nanyang International Airport has seen a steady increase in passenger traffic. In the last year, the airport handled approximately 232,315 passengers, reflecting its growing importance in the region. On average, there are about seven passenger flights scheduled to take off from Yancheng every day, connecting travelers to various destinations across China and beyond.

How to Get Here

Getting to Yancheng Nanyang International Airport is convenient, with several transportation options available:

  • Bus: You can take bus line 11 from the North Bus Station to the Technician College, then transfer to bus line 98, which will take you directly to the airport. The journey takes about 1 hour and 10 minutes and costs around CNY 3.
  • Taxi: A taxi ride from downtown Yancheng to the airport takes approximately 25 minutes and costs around CNY 30.
  • Train: For those coming from further away, high-speed trains are available from Nanyang Railway Station, taking about two hours to reach the airport, with ticket prices around CNY 100.

Terminal Layout

Yancheng Nanyang International Airport features two terminals: Terminal 1 (T1) is dedicated to domestic flights, while Terminal 2 (T2) serves both domestic and international flights. The terminals are designed to accommodate a growing number of passengers, with T2 covering an area of 40,000 square meters and having the capacity to handle up to 4.5 million passengers annually. T2 consists of three levels, with the first level housing the arrival hall and the upper levels designated for departures.
